There were 4 people in the room. Each has 3/5 of a bottle ink left. How many markers worth of ink were there in the room

Respuesta :

Аноним Аноним
  • 03-12-2015
To answer this you would just multiply 4*3/5 because 4 people have 3/5 ink left. The easiest way to do that is change 3/5 into a decimal.
3/5 = 0.6
4*0.6 = 2.4
So, there are 2.4 markers worth of ink in the room.
